柯林斯词典

  • ADJ (次序)下降的,递减的
    When a group of things is listed or arrangedin descending order, each thing is smaller or less important than the thing before it.
    1. All the other ingredients, including water, have to be listed in descending order by weight.
      所有其他原料,包括水在内,都需要根据重量依次降序排列。
